From 78a4df6ad36a5cdf18d40ef539e0ce9609c71b4f Mon Sep 17 00:00:00 2001 From: 44323 <443237572@qq.com> Date: 星期六, 07 十月 2023 15:33:28 +0800 Subject: [PATCH] Merge branch 'master' of http://120.76.84.145:10101/gitblit/r/java/PlayPai --- cloud-server-other/src/main/java/com/dsh/other/controller/SiteController.java | 39 ++++++++++++++++++++++++++++++++------- 1 files changed, 32 insertions(+), 7 deletions(-) diff --git a/cloud-server-other/src/main/java/com/dsh/other/controller/SiteController.java b/cloud-server-other/src/main/java/com/dsh/other/controller/SiteController.java index 9d8a468..5c0343c 100644 --- a/cloud-server-other/src/main/java/com/dsh/other/controller/SiteController.java +++ b/cloud-server-other/src/main/java/com/dsh/other/controller/SiteController.java @@ -32,10 +32,7 @@ import javax.servlet.http.HttpServletRequest; import javax.servlet.http.HttpServletResponse; import java.io.PrintWriter; -import java.util.ArrayList; -import java.util.Date; -import java.util.List; -import java.util.Map; +import java.util.*; /** * @author zhibing.pu @@ -65,16 +62,28 @@ @Autowired private CityManagerClient cityManagerClient; - + /** + * 获取所有场地 + */ + @RequestMapping("/base/site/getList") + @ResponseBody + public List<Site> getList(){ + return siteService.list(new QueryWrapper<Site>().ne("state",3)); + } + /** + * 获取场地预约记录 + */ + @RequestMapping("/base/site/listAll") + public List<SiteBooking> listAll(@RequestBody SiteBookingQuery query){ + return siteBookingService.listAll(query); + } /** * 获取所有场地 * @return */ @RequestMapping("/base/site/list") public List<TSiteDTO> listAll(@RequestBody SiteSearchVO vo){ - return siteTypeService.listAll(vo); - } /** * 获取场地有效期在两个月内的场地列表 @@ -304,6 +313,22 @@ return ResultUtil.runErr(); } } + @ResponseBody + @PostMapping("/api/site/queryMySiteById") + @ApiOperation(value = "获取我的预约场地列表详情2.0", tags = {"用户—预约场地"}) + @ApiImplicitParams({ + @ApiImplicitParam(value = "id", name = "id", dataType = "int", required = true), + @ApiImplicitParam(name = "Authorization", value = "Bearer +token", required = true, dataType = "String", paramType = "header", defaultValue = "Bearer eyJhbGciOiJIUzUxMiJ9....."), + }) + public ResultUtil<SiteBooking> queryMySiteById(Integer id){ + try { + SiteBooking byId = siteBookingService.getById(id); + return ResultUtil.success(byId); + }catch (Exception e){ + e.printStackTrace(); + return ResultUtil.runErr(); + } + } @ResponseBody -- Gitblit v1.7.1